Land cover change across 45 years in the world’s largest mangrove forest (Sundarbans): the contribution of remote sensing in forest monitoring
This study explored the land use land cover (LULC) change over 45 years (1975 -2020) in the world’s largest mangrove forest, Sundarbansusing Landsat imagery.
